French town veers to far-right in election
2 years ago
302
The French town of Meaux, a conservative stronghold east of Paris, was one of dozens of constituencies to fall to the Rassemblement National (RN) party of Marine Le Pen for the first time in a parliamentary election, as disaffected voters expressed their frustration toward President Emmanuel Macron.
